Active Essex honours county champ Alice with Inspired Athlete award

by | Oct 8, 2014

Essex Under-15 champion Alice Green has been selected for an Active Essex Inspired Athlete award for the second year running.

The Billericay schoolgirl, who also made her England squash debut in Ireland last season, received the special Bronze Award and a cheque for £500 as recognition for her achievements over the past 12 months and also as an incentive to do even more.

“This really is an honour,” said Alice, who will be captain of the Essex U-15 girls’ Inter-County squad this weekend. “I’m thrilled with the award and the money will really help towards paying for the cost of coaching, travelling to events and equipment.”

Alice will now become an Active Essex Ambassador to help inspire other children to take up sport. She will attend various sporting events where she will talk about what she has achieved and how other kids can follow in her footsteps.

Her mum, Jo McGowan added:” Alice is really looking forward to telling others all about squash and what a great game it is. Active Essex has been great recognising the efforts and success that she has achieved. The money is really helpful too. It will go towards tournament fees, coaching, personal training and shoes. She plans to play in some internationals this season, including the French Open in February, so it really helps. Last year we travelled several thousand miles to tournaments up and down the country and to and from training.”

Alice’s potential and recent successes have also caught the attention of top racket company Head and clothing manufacturer IproSports and both companies are now sponsoring the Club Kingswood player.
